About The Role
The Standards and Practices Operator (RP) is an early career role within Disney’s Corporate Standards & Practices team, supporting the delivery of high-quality live television content that reflects our world-class entertainment brands. Operating as part of the Legal and Business Affairs Group, you will apply formal training and developing expertise to help protect Disney’s reputation while enabling innovative storytellers to reach global audiences

- Monitor live television feeds from our facility and execute edits in real time to manage audio and video content during broadcasts.
- Operate delay systems, including engaging the “delay button” and inserting mutes, bleeps, and cutaways to mitigate risk and uphold content standards.
- Apply established rules and guidelines to live content, using sound judgment to make immediate decisions under pressure.
- Maintain active visual and audio monitoring for extended periods, ensuring continuous focus and rapid response to emerging issues.
- Collaborate with Standards & Practices and production partners to align on expectations for live events and escalate issues when needed.
- Manage assigned schedules for select live broadcasts, including evenings, weekends, and occasional holidays, demonstrating punctuality and ownership of shifts.
- Stay current on contemporary speech and trends in television and other media to inform contextual decision-making during live content review.
